The Scars In Pneuma (“The Scars in the Soul” – from “πνεύμα”, ancient Greek word for “breath”, “breath of life” and, in a religious context, for “spirit”, “soul”) is a black metal act based in Brescia, Italy. The band will release their debut album via Promethean Fire / Kolony Records in early 2019. The record is a visceral, multi-faceted flow that often blurs the line between black, death and melodic death-doom metal. More details, pre-orders, alongside many more news will be unveiled soon. In the meantime, a song off the album, first single "Spark To Fire To Sun", is now streaming on YouTube. Check it out HERE! The Scars In Pneuma initially started as a solo project of Lorenzo Marchello (vocals / guitars / bass) in the beginning of 2017, and it turned to a band when trusted musicians Francesco Lupi (guitars) and Daniele Valseriati (drums) joined the ranks later during the same year. As we have hinted at above, musically, The Scars In Pneuma provides it's own particular black metal style, which can be defined as a mix of black metal, death metal with melodic riffing and epic passages, with a touch of doomy mood. Some bands that can be cited as inspiration are Dissection, Mgła, Be'lakor, Rotting Christ, Forgotten Tomb, Blut Aus Nord, Emperor. Lyrically, The Scars In Pneuma is all about themes such as dealing with your own demons, life's biggest regrets, the passing of time, the beloved people we lost. Escaping from the dark places in the imagination, Portuguese hellions Besta take inspiration from horror movies and blend them into a frantic, feedback-laden mash-up of punk-rock and old school grindcore, imagine Bad Brains mutating alongside Napalm Death, always with their own creative vein on top of every tune they deliver, with a political axe to grind, shouted on their native Portuguese tongue. With 9 confrontational releases since 2012, and shows alongside Eyehategod, Napalm Death, Cattle Decapitation, Mob 47, Cryptopsy, Possessed, Massgrave, Deathrite, Obituary, Mantar or Conan to name a few, touring between Europe and South America and solid appearances on festivals such as Obscene Extreme or Resurrection Fest. The year 2019 set a new chapter, signing with Germany´s Lifeforce Records and the band 2nd full length album titled "Eterno Rancor", a socially conscious record from 4 guys that feeds on pulverizing and skull fracturing punk/grindcore, raucous landscapes, and honesty. One of black metal's best-kept secrets, Ulvdalir belong to the inner circle of Russia's True Ingrian Black Metal Death, alongside Iron Bonehead labelmates Khashm, with whom they share two members. As such, the sound they've patiently crafted since 2001 - and which made its full-length debut in 2008 with TWO albums, Flame Once Lost and Soul Void, both equally aptly titled - likewise bears a tangibly gnarly physicality contrasted by an almost-levitational aspect: truly, an alchemical melding of aggression and atmosphere. And although they've kept their profile reasonably visible in the intervening years with myriad split recordings and a compilation unearthing a couple lost EPs, ...Of Death Eternal is the first Ulvdalir full-length recording in nearly eight years. Truly worth the wait, ...Of Death Eternal displays the full bloom of Ulvdalir's rotten, bountiful harvest. Swarming with dire intent and unnervingly precise malice, the quartet's attack here pushes and pulls, coils and crushes, but always carries an ever-forward momentum. Equally slipstreaming and trance-inducing, their gnarled 'n' gnarling style of black metal emits space and shade at every crooked turn, finally enveloping the listener whole within their black hole. And each of the album's six central songs patiently unfolds their respective black holes across lengthier track times, yet ones never too exhaustingly long; again, malicious precision is the order of the day on ...Of Death Eternal. In that regard, and alongside the finesse physicality here, one could slot Ulvdalir alongside the more orthodox black metal movements still coursing through Sweden and Greece, but with a sterner sensibility that's distinctly Russian.
